80C51单片机存储器结构与并行口详解
需积分: 0 85 浏览量
更新于2024-08-20
收藏 1.15MB PPT 举报
"C的片内存储器-51单片机课件"
本文将深入探讨80C51单片机的片内存储器结构及其相关特性,包括80C51系列概述、基本结构、存储器组织以及并行口结构与操作。80C51是Intel公司MCS-51系列中的一个代表,它采用了CHMOS工艺,兼备高速度、高密度和低功耗的优点,并且与TTL和CMOS电平兼容。
80C51系列单片机包含基本型和增强型两类,基本型如8051、80C51等,而增强型如8052、80C52等。这些单片机在片内程序存储器配置上有不同形式,例如80C51带有4K字节的掩膜ROM,87C51则有EPROM,而80C31则没有片内程序存储器。此外,不同厂家如ATMEL、Philips等也基于8051核心开发了自己的产品。
80C51的片内存储器分为4K字节的程序存储器和128字节的数据存储器,分别位于000H~0FFFH和00H~7FH的地址范围内。这种分离的存储空间设计被称为哈佛结构,有利于程序执行和数据处理的并行操作。
在并行口结构与操作方面,80C51具有多个并行I/O端口,如P0、P1、P2和P3,它们可以作为通用I/O口或者作为地址/数据总线的一部分。这些并行口在不同的应用模式下有不同的功能,如总线型应用模式下的“三总线”模式,用于连接外部存储器和外设;非总线型应用的“多I/O”模式则适用于简单的输入输出控制。
2.2.1 80C51的基本结构包括CPU、运算器、控制器、寄存器组和外部和内部存储器接口。其中,寄存器组包含了工作寄存器、累加器、标志寄存器等,它们对于高效计算至关重要。
2.2.2 80C51的应用模式涵盖了总线型和非总线型两种。总线型应用模式中,单片机通过数据总线、地址总线和控制总线与外部设备通信,适合扩展存储器和复杂的系统设计。非总线型应用模式则更多地依赖于单片机的内置I/O口,简化了硬件连接,适用于小型控制系统。
80C51单片机凭借其独特的存储器组织、并行口结构和灵活的应用模式,在嵌入式系统和工业控制领域中得到了广泛应用。理解其内部结构和工作原理,对于设计和开发基于80C51的系统至关重要。
2021-10-25 上传
2009-10-22 上传
2010-11-28 上传
2010-03-14 上传
2009-12-10 上传
2012-02-14 上传
2010-04-25 上传
2010-11-28 上传
2022-05-17 上传
冀北老许
- 粉丝: 16
- 资源: 2万+
最新资源
- 探索数据转换实验平台在设备装置中的应用
- 使用git-log-to-tikz.py将Git日志转换为TIKZ图形
- 小栗子源码2.9.3版本发布
- 使用Tinder-Hack-Client实现Tinder API交互
- Android Studio新模板:个性化Material Design导航抽屉
- React API分页模块:数据获取与页面管理
- C语言实现顺序表的动态分配方法
- 光催化分解水产氢固溶体催化剂制备技术揭秘
- VS2013环境下tinyxml库的32位与64位编译指南
- 网易云歌词情感分析系统实现与架构
- React应用展示GitHub用户详细信息及项目分析
- LayUI2.1.6帮助文档API功能详解
- 全栈开发实现的chatgpt应用可打包小程序/H5/App
- C++实现顺序表的动态内存分配技术
- Java制作水果格斗游戏:策略与随机性的结合
- 基于若依框架的后台管理系统开发实例解析